Springhill Suites Los Angeles Lax/Manhattan Beach - Hawthorne
33.89881, -118.37782Springhill Suites Los Angeles Lax/Manhattan Beach Hawthorne hotel is situated merely 9 minutes' stroll from AdventurePlex Playground and boasts spa therapy and various recreational opportunities. Featuring a convenience store, this comfortable 3-star hotel is 1.5 miles from Sepulveda Shopping Center.
Location
Dotted with bars and restaurants, the modern Springhill Suites Los Angeles Lax/Manhattan Beach is nestled near the business district of Hawthorne. The Hawthorne hotel is stationed around 25 minutes by foot from Del Aire Park. The Hawthorne property is situated 1.1 miles from Polliwog Park.
Springhill Suites Los Angeles Lax/Manhattan Beach hotel is located within walking distance of Douglas city rail.
Rooms
There are 164 rooms comprising a seating area. They come with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as such comforts as an ironing set and climate control. Furnished with a couch and a writing table, the rooms also have tea and coffee making equipment. Offering such amenities as hair dryers and towels, the bathrooms also include a bath, a roll-in shower, and a separate toilet. Every king suite has a private, kitchen including a microwave, coffee and tea making equipment, and a refrigerator.
Eat & Drink
Drinks are available at the snack bar. The hotel is a mere 8 minutes by foot from Paul Martin's American Grill.
Leisure & Business
The non-smoking Springhill Suites Los Angeles Lax/Manhattan Beach Hawthorne has a swimming pool and a fitness club. Additionally, staying at the property, active guests can enjoy a golf course on site. Business travelers are welcome to use a meeting room and a conference space offered on site.
